The Komata Road.

The following telegram was received by the Town Clerk to-day, in reply to sundry telegrams sent by him re the Komata Road. We sincerely trust that the efforts made will prove successful :— Wellington, This day. "I prefer my certainty to that of the . Borough Council, however, the Hon. Mr Whitaker has undertaken on his return to Auckland to endeavor to arrange for the construction of the road by County Council. I hope he may succeed.—John Betcb."
